Van Helsing represents a unique era in Hollywood filmmaking where practical effects, expansive gothic sets, and early digital CGI converged. Stephen Sommers, hot off the success of The Mummy (1999) and The Mummy Returns (2001), brought his signature high-octane energy to the Victorian horror landscape. A Masterclass in Monster Mashups

In the contemporary media landscape, while legacy piracy and third-party streaming sites remain part of the internet fabric, mainstream over-the-top (OTT) platforms have increasingly recognized the value of regional audio tracks. Major global streaming services now routinely offer multi-audio support, including Tamil, Telugu, and Hindi dubs for international releases, validating the demand that platforms like Tamilyogi historically highlighted.
